Welcome aboard. This is the weekly release note for FeedCheck, our podcast feed validator at Larkwhistle Media. Version 2.4 adds stricter enclosure-size checks and better handling of malformed pubDate fields. Nothing in this build changes the CLI flags, so existing scripts on the Penhallow servers should run unmodified. Staging validation passed overnight; the full regression suite finished clean this morning. If you see failures, flag them in the release channel before Thursday. The trace token for this build follows.

build token for fajep-yajof: htk9_7d88c0238

## Quarterly Cash-Flow Forecast — Branch Summary

The Q3 forecast for Ardenfell Holdings shows inflows tracking four percent above plan, driven by early settlements in the Greymoor branches. Outflows remain within tolerance, though equipment leasing costs warrant closer review. Branch managers should hold discretionary spend steady until the mid-quarter checkpoint. Liquidity remains comfortable under all modelled scenarios. The strategic implications for next year's investment plan appear in the note below.

board note of yahig-baguf: The renewal with Ralwynek Holdings closes at $20 million a year, 20 percent above the last contract. Project Druix slips by two quarters because of the staffing delay.

Ticket: Resolver drift on Lanternfish lookup service

We're seeing intermittent DNS resolution failures in the Lanternfish staging pods. Root cause appears to be configuration drift: two nodes still carry the old resolver timeout and search suffixes. Please reconcile them against the canonical set. The expected configuration values are listed below.

settings of bawif-fawif:
ralix:
  log_level: warn
  metrics_host: metrics.ralix.tolvaqsys.internal
  pool_size: 32